Well, let’s talk about one of the most famous and perhaps most controversial aesthetic treatments: Botox. You’ve certainly heard the word Botox, but you might not know exactly what it does or what its uses are. See, Botox is actually the brand name for Botulinum Toxin Type A. The word “toxin” might sound a bit scary, but when used by an aesthetic dermatologist in very small, controlled amounts, it works wonders. Its main job is to temporarily block nerve signals to specific muscles. When this happens, those muscles relax and cannot contract, and as a result, the wrinkles caused by the movement of those muscles become less visible or disappear entirely.
Botox is usually used for lines on the upper face. For example: frown lines (those vertical lines between the eyebrows that make a person look angry), forehead lines (those horizontal lines that appear when you’re surprised), and crow’s feet (wrinkles around the eyes that appear when you smile or frown). The result is a smoother, younger-looking face that still appears natural. And this point about being natural is very important; no one wants their face to look expressionless.

The effect of Botox usually lasts between 3 to 6 months. After that, its effect gradually fades, and you can return for another injection. The interesting point is that Botox isn’t just for aesthetics; a dermatologist can also use it to treat chronic migraines, muscle spasms, or even excessive sweating (hyperhidrosis). 💧 Dermal Fillers: Restoring Volume and Freshness
After Botox, another highly popular ‘knight’ of rejuvenation is ‘dermal filler’ or simply ‘filling gels’. So, what exactly do they do? As we mentioned, with age, collagen and elastin in the skin decrease, but there’s another problem: loss of subcutaneous fat and bone structure. This causes the face to appear hollow, cheeks to sag, and deeper lines like nasolabial folds (laugh lines) or marionette lines (those lines that run from the corners of the mouth down to the chin) to emerge. Fillers step in here to replenish this lost volume and give the face a fresher, fuller appearance.
Most dermal fillers used at Kian Derm are hyaluronic acid-based. You might ask, what is hyaluronic acid? Well, this substance naturally exists in our body, and its job is to absorb water and keep the skin hydrated. It acts like a sponge that holds water, making the skin look plump and smooth. When these fillers are injected into specific areas of the face, they not only restore lost volume but also deeply hydrate the skin. The result is softer, smoother, and more radiant skin.
So, where can fillers be used? Their applications are very diverse: filling nasolabial folds and marionette lines, increasing cheek volume for a face lift, shaping and augmenting lips, filling under-eye hollows, shaping the chin and jawline, and even improving the appearance of hands. 🌟 New Skin Rejuvenation Techniques: Microneedling, PRP, and Mesotherapy
Now that you’re familiar with Botox and fillers, let’s move on to a series of other techniques that truly have a lot to say in skin rejuvenation. These methods primarily focus on naturally stimulating the skin to repair and regenerate itself. You might have heard their names: Microneedling, PRP (Platelet-Rich Plasma), and Mesotherapy. Each of them cleverly signals the skin to say, “Hey, it’s time to repair yourself!”
First of all, “Microneedling.” Well, the name sounds a bit scary, doesn’t it? But don’t worry! In this method, using a special device with very tiny, delicate needles, very small punctures are created on the skin’s surface. These punctures are invisible and don’t actually wound the skin. What’s the goal? When these microscopic punctures are created, the skin thinks it’s been damaged and begins to repair itself. This repair process leads to increased production of collagen and elastin. The result? Improvement in acne scars, reduction in fine lines and wrinkles, shrinking of enlarged pores, and overall improvement in skin texture and tone. Microneedling essentially forces the skin to become younger and more vibrant.
Next is “PRP” or “Platelet-Rich Plasma.” This one is really interesting because it uses your own blood! Yes, you heard right. A small amount of blood is drawn from you (like a regular blood test), then it’s placed in a centrifuge machine to separate platelets from other blood components. These platelets are full of growth factors that are very important for tissue repair and regeneration. Then, this platelet-rich plasma is injected into the desired areas of the skin. PRP can be used for overall skin rejuvenation, improving scars, reducing hair loss, and even improving the quality of the skin under the eyes. This is a completely natural method because it uses your body’s own materials, and no foreign chemicals are introduced into your body.
And finally, “Mesotherapy.” In this method, a series of vitamins, minerals, hyaluronic acid, and specific medications are injected with very fine needles into the middle layer of the skin. The goal of mesotherapy, like the others, is to stimulate the skin to produce collagen and elastin and deeply hydrate the skin. This method is used to improve skin hydration, reduce cellulite, lighten dark spots, and even strengthen hair roots. 💡 Laser and Advanced Devices: Modern Tools in the Hands of a Specialist
Well, let’s move on to the exciting part: lasers and advanced devices! These technologies have truly revolutionized the world of beauty and empowered dermatologists to treat a wide range of problems. If you thought until now that lasers were only for hair removal, you are sorely mistaken! The applications of lasers in aesthetic dermatology are much broader and more diverse than that. These devices, with high precision and delicacy, can target specific areas of the skin and resolve problems without harming surrounding tissues.
One of the main applications of lasers is “skin rejuvenation.” Lasers can stimulate collagen and elastin production, leading to skin tightening, reduction of wrinkles, and overall improvement in skin texture. For example, Fractional Lasers send microscopic columns of laser energy into the skin, prompting it to repair and regenerate. The result is smoother, brighter, and fresher skin. It’s like giving your skin a second chance to renew itself.
“Treatment of skin spots and pigmentation” is another key application of lasers. Brown spots caused by sun exposure, freckles, melasma, and even old tattoos can be effectively removed with specific lasers like Q-switched Laser or PicoSure Laser. These lasers target excess pigments in the skin, breaking them into smaller particles so the body can eliminate them. Of course, this requires a great deal of precision and experience from the dermatologist to perform it in the best possible way without damaging healthy skin.
In addition to these, lasers for “hair removal” are already well-known to everyone. This method offers a more permanent and convenient solution compared to traditional methods like waxing and shaving. “Treatment of varicose veins and skin redness” (like rosacea) is also possible with vascular lasers. 🌱 Long-term Skin Health: Maintenance and Prevention
Well, we’ve reached a very important point that many might forget: “Skin health is not a sprint, it’s a marathon!” What does that mean? It means that after undergoing a series of aesthetic treatments, you shouldn’t think your work is done and you can leave everything to itself. No way! Maintaining those results and caring for your skin long-term is just as important as undergoing the treatments. Just like a plant that, after being planted, still needs water and light to grow.
“Daily skincare” is paramount. This includes a simple but effective routine: daily cleansing (morning and night) to remove dirt and makeup, using an appropriate toner to balance skin pH, and of course, a good moisturizer to maintain skin hydration. And most importantly, “sunscreen”! Sunscreen should pretty much be your skin’s best friend, every day, even on cloudy days, even indoors; don’t think it’s only necessary in summer. Harmful sun rays are the main cause of premature skin aging, spots, and even skin cancer.
